Fuel Pressure

2011 Chevrolet Traverse FWD V6-3.6LSECTION Fuel Pressure



Fuel pressure

Ignition ON, engine OFF 345-690 kPa (50-100 psi)

Engine idling at normal operating temperature 300-400 kpa (43-58 psi)


Relieve the fuel pressure to 69 kPa (10 psi). Verify that the fuel pressure does not decrease greater than 14 kPa (2 psi) in 5 min


Note: DO NOT perform the Fuel System Diagnosis if the engine coolant temperature is above 60°C (150°F). High fuel pressure readings may result due to hot soak fuel boiling. With the engine OFF, the fuel pressure may increase beyond the pressure relief regulator valve's setting point of 690 kPa (100 psi) ± 5 percent.
